2012-03-05 220 views

回答

11

您需要创建一个名为.gdbinit的新文件 - 将其放在您的主目录中。现在每次gdb启动时它都会执行这个文件中的命令。 “.gdbinit”是一个文件,您可以将它放在您的主目录中,gdb将在gdb启动时从命令行或从Xcode中解析。

+0

现在感谢我的主目录中的.gdbinit文件。我在哪里可以找到崩溃结果? – saman01 2012-03-06 10:56:17

+0

您可以将此系统默认值添加到.gdbinit中,以将Xcode的GDB输出记录到文件中。所以当你执行你的程序时,你的日志将被写入日志文件: 默认写入com.apple.dt.Xcode IDEGDBLogToFile /tmp/logs.txt – pansp 2012-03-06 16:33:18

14

您也可以将.gdbinit放在您的调试文件夹中,这使得更适用于调试不同的应用程序。 GDB将自动加载./.gdbinit进行当前调试。

0

你可以做

纳米〜/ .gdbinit

修改文件并保存。使用cat验证更改〜/ .gdbinit